JUL: fix out of tree build
authorMathieu Desnoyers <mathieu.desnoyers@efficios.com>
Fri, 15 Nov 2013 18:24:40 +0000 (13:24 -0500)
committerMathieu Desnoyers <mathieu.desnoyers@efficios.com>
Fri, 15 Nov 2013 18:24:40 +0000 (13:24 -0500)
Signed-off-by: Mathieu Desnoyers <mathieu.desnoyers@efficios.com>
liblttng-ust-java/Makefile.am
liblttng-ust-jul/Makefile.am
tests/java-jul/Makefile.am

index 5d43cfc713a5ccf4f28f1ab7b8e434e16424963e..37867a7cdf45b115e1ec131b2ebbf47f4ac45817 100644 (file)
@@ -26,8 +26,8 @@ clean-local:
 
 LTTngUst.c: org_lttng_ust_LTTngUst.h
 
-$(LTTNG_JUST_DESTDIR)/LTTngUst.class: $(LTTNG_JUST_DESTDIR)/LTTngUst.java
-       $(JCC)/javac -d "$(builddir)" "$(LTTNG_JUST_DESTDIR)/LTTngUst.java"
+$(LTTNG_JUST_DESTDIR)/LTTngUst.class: $(LTTNG_JUST_SRCDIR)/LTTngUst.java
+       $(JCC)/javac -d "$(builddir)" "$(LTTNG_JUST_SRCDIR)/LTTngUst.java"
 
 org_lttng_ust_LTTngUst.h: $(LTTNG_JUST_DESTDIR)/LTTngUst.class
        $(JCC)/javah org.lttng.ust.LTTngUst
index ffcc53804293818f66d58fa55e02a46ba58ec019..89c908045980858c36ddcd3c0565826617d43b17 100644 (file)
@@ -24,8 +24,10 @@ else
 JCC=javac
 endif
 
-all-local: $(LTTNG_JUL_DESTDIR)/LTTngAgent.class $(LTTNG_JUL_DESTDIR)/LTTngUst.class \
-               org_lttng_ust_jul_LTTngUst.h liblttng-ust-jul.jar
+all-local: $(LTTNG_JUL_DESTDIR)/LTTngAgent.class \
+               $(LTTNG_JUL_DESTDIR)/LTTngUst.class \
+               org_lttng_ust_jul_LTTngUst.h \
+               liblttng-ust-jul.jar
 
 clean-local:
        rm -f org_lttng_ust_jul_LTTngUst.h
@@ -34,16 +36,23 @@ clean-local:
 
 LTTngUst.c: org_lttng_ust_jul_LTTngUst.h
 
-$(LTTNG_JUL_DESTDIR)/LTTngUst.class: $(LTTNG_JUL_SRCDIR)/LTTngUst.java
-       $(JCC)/javac -d "$(builddir)" "$(LTTNG_JUL_SRCDIR)/LTTngUst.java"
+%.class: %.java
+       $(JCC)/javac -d "$(builddir)" $<
 
-$(LTTNG_JUL_DESTDIR)/LTTngAgent.class: $(LTTNG_JUL_SRCDIR)/LTTngAgent.java
-       $(JCC)/javac -d "$(builddir)" "$(LTTNG_JUL_SRCDIR)/LTTngAgent.java"
+LTTNG_AGENT_FILES = $(LTTNG_JUL_SRCDIR)/LTTngAgent.java \
+               $(LTTNG_JUL_SRCDIR)/LTTngLogHandler.java \
+               $(LTTNG_JUL_SRCDIR)/LTTngSessiondCmd2_4.java \
+               $(LTTNG_JUL_SRCDIR)/LTTngTCPSessiondClient.java \
+               $(LTTNG_JUL_SRCDIR)/LTTngThread.java
+
+$(LTTNG_JUL_DESTDIR)/LTTngAgent.class: $(LTTNG_AGENT_FILES) \
+               $(LTTNG_JUL_DESTDIR)/LTTngUst.class
+       $(JCC)/javac -d "$(builddir)" $(LTTNG_AGENT_FILES)
 
 org_lttng_ust_jul_LTTngUst.h: $(LTTNG_JUL_DESTDIR)/LTTngUst.class
        $(JCC)/javah org.lttng.ust.jul.LTTngUst
 
-liblttng-ust-jul.jar: $(LTTNG_JUL_DESTDIR)/LTTngUst.class $(LTTNG_JUL_DESTDIR)/LTTngAgent.class
+liblttng-ust-jul.jar: $(LTTNG_JUL_DESTDIR)/LTTngAgent.class
        $(JCC)/jar cf liblttng-ust-jul.jar \
                $(LTTNG_JUL_DESTDIR)/*.class
 
index b4dfc4caffb2aa356b14f41e860140d12298da3f..ba50fbf1360b6911a61f5cece42bf42b2b0842bc 100644 (file)
@@ -10,7 +10,7 @@ endif
 
 AM_CPPFLAGS = -I$(top_srcdir)/include
 
-JUL_jar_file = "$(srcdir)/../../liblttng-ust-jul/liblttng-ust-jul.jar"
+JUL_jar_file = "$(builddir)/../../liblttng-ust-jul/liblttng-ust-jul.jar"
 
 default: all
 
This page took 0.026746 seconds and 4 git commands to generate.